Polyurea spray coating is a new development in recent years. This coating provides a plastic-like look and feel when sprayed over any type of foam. The coating is hard yet durable, providing a strong cover for any foam cutting project and protecting it from breakage or weather damage.

This coating can be applied to any foam project including signs, lettering, logos, accessories, and crown molding. Polyurea coating combines high flexibility and durability with high hardness, and is a fast-drying type of coating. It can be cured even at very low temperatures due to its chemical properties, and it is not necessary to use a catalyst. After being coated, the foam can be sanded to a smooth or textured finish, depending on customer needs. It can also be painted with any type of paint, including water-based paint such as latex, or oil-based paint, as well as automotive paint. This coating dries in minutes, providing a coating resistant to abrasion and harsh chemicals, without blisters. Since polyurea dries very quickly, it requires efficient mixing and spraying techniques, preferably using a spray gun.

This material is non-toxic and completely safe for use. Any type of foam can be sprayed, including rigid foam and soft polyurethane foam. Spraying can apply both a smooth and textured finish. In addition, it has many advantages, some of them include high curing speed (even at low temperatures), water resistance, protection against humid, hot, cold and sunny conditions, extreme abrasion resistance, thermal shock resistance, chemical resistance. , little or no odour, good adherence to the material on which it is projected and unlimited application thickness.

Due to the unique physical and chemical properties of polyurea, especially being tough and capable of serving as insulation, there are many industries that have recently made great use of it. Some of them include the concrete industry, floors, roofs, bedliners, tunnels, pipes, bridge lining, tank lining and lining, marine, decorative and architectural designs, among others.
